
无论是初创公司还是大型企业,高效、安全地管理数据库资源都是确保业务连续性和竞争力的关键
而在众多数据库管理工具中,Navicat for MySQL凭借其强大的功能、用户友好的界面以及高度的安全性,脱颖而出,成为众多数据库管理员和开发者的首选
本文将深入探讨Navicat for MySQL的优势、核心功能、实际应用场景及其为企业带来的价值
一、Navicat for MySQL简介 Navicat是PremiumSoft CyberTech公司开发的一款多功能数据库管理工具,支持多种数据库系统,包括MySQL、MariaDB、MongoDB、SQLite、Oracle、PostgreSQL和SQL Server等
其中,Navicat for MySQL专为MySQL数据库设计,旨在提供一站式解决方案,满足从数据库设计、开发到维护的全过程需求
它结合了图形用户界面(GUI)和命令行界面(CLI)的优点,使得数据库操作既直观又灵活
二、核心功能解析 1.直观易用的界面 Navicat for MySQL采用了现代化的用户界面设计,布局清晰,色彩搭配合理,极大降低了学习成本
工具栏、菜单栏、连接面板、对象列表和查询编辑器等元素的巧妙布局,使得用户能够迅速上手,即使是初学者也能轻松管理复杂的数据库结构
2.全面的数据库管理 该工具支持创建、修改和删除数据库、表、视图、索引、触发器、存储过程等数据库对象
用户可以通过拖拽方式直观地进行表结构设计,同时,Navicat还提供了丰富的数据类型选项和约束设置,确保数据库设计的规范性和高效性
此外,它还支持导入/导出数据,支持多种格式(如CSV、Excel、JSON等),方便数据的迁移和备份
3.强大的数据查询与分析 Navicat for MySQL内置了强大的查询编辑器,支持语法高亮、自动完成、参数化查询等功能,大大提高了SQL编写的效率和准确性
用户可以直接在工具内执行SQL脚本,查看结果集,甚至对结果进行排序、筛选和导出
此外,它还集成了数据同步和比较工具,便于在不同数据库之间迁移数据或识别数据差异
4.高效的数据迁移与同步 对于需要跨数据库平台迁移数据的场景,Navicat提供了数据传输功能,支持从一个数据库到另一个数据库的数据迁移,包括结构迁移和数据迁移,极大地简化了数据整合流程
同时,它还支持定时同步任务,确保数据的实时性和一致性,这对于需要频繁更新数据的业务场景尤为重要
5.安全可靠的访问控制 安全性是数据库管理的核心考量之一
Navicat for MySQL支持SSL/TLS加密连接,保护数据传输过程中的安全
此外,它还提供了精细的权限管理功能,允许管理员为不同用户设置不同的访问权限,确保敏感数据的访问受到严格控制
结合角色管理功能,进一步简化了权限配置工作
6.自动化与脚本化操作 为了提升工作效率,Navicat支持任务调度和批处理操作,用户可以预设一系列操作作为任务,设定触发条件(如时间、事件),实现自动化管理
同时,它还支持生成和执行SQL脚本,方便进行批量处理和自动化测试
三、实际应用场景 1.开发团队的协作 在软件开发项目中,Navicat for MySQL成为开发团队共享数据库设计、测试数据和执行SQL脚本的桥梁
团队成员可以基于同一数据库模型进行开发,减少了因数据不一致导致的错误,提高了协作效率
2.数据仓库管理 对于拥有大型数据仓库的企业而言,Navicat提供了高效的数据导入导出、数据同步和查询优化功能,有助于快速构建和维护数据仓库,支持复杂的数据分析需求
3.网站与应用程序支持 许多网站和应用程序依赖于MySQL数据库存储用户信息和业务数据
Navicat for MySQL简化了数据库的日常维护工作,如数据备份、恢复、性能监控等,确保了网站和应用的稳定运行
4.教育与学习 作为学习工具,Navicat的直观界面和丰富功能使得数据库初学者能够快速掌握MySQL数据库的基本操作,通过实践加深对数据库原理的理解
四、价值体现 1.提升工作效率 Navicat for MySQL通过自动化工具和直观界面,显著缩短了数据库管理任务的执行时间,使管理员能够专注于更复杂的业务逻辑和数据分析
2.降低成本 通过减少手动操作错误和数据丢失的风险,Navicat降低了因数据问题导致的业务中断和修复成本
同时,其跨平台支持能力避免了因更换数据库平台而产生的额外成本
3.增强数据安全性 强大的加密技术和精细的权限管理策略,有效保护了企业敏感数据的安全,降低了数据泄露的风险
4.促进业务创新 高效的数据库管理能力为企业提供了坚实的数据支撑,使得企业能够更快地响应市场变化,推动产品和服务的创新
结语 综上所述,Navicat for MySQL凭借其全面而强大的功能集、直观易用的界面设计以及高度的安全性和可靠性,成为了数据库管理员和开发者的得力助手
无论是在提升工作效率、降低成本、增强数据安全性,还是促进业务创新方面,Navicat都展现出了显著的价值
随着数字化转型的深入,Navicat for MySQL将继续发挥其重要作用,助力企业更好地管理和利用数据资源,推动业务的持续发展和创新
选择Navicat for MySQL,就是选择了高效、安全和可靠的数据库管理解决方案
Navicat MySQL:高效管理数据库,提升数据操作新体验
快速分享MySQL表:导出与发送指南
IDEA项目如何更换MySQL数据库
MySQL支持的语言种类概览
MySQL数据库快速导入指南
MySQL中两字段值相加技巧
MySQL权限管理:如何赋予与撤销数据库用户权限
快速分享MySQL表:导出与发送指南
IDEA项目如何更换MySQL数据库
MySQL支持的语言种类概览
MySQL数据库快速导入指南
MySQL中两字段值相加技巧
MySQL权限管理:如何赋予与撤销数据库用户权限
MySQL数据库安装与使用指南
MySQL中MediumText数据类型应用指南
解压安装MySQL,轻松上手教程
MySQL版本同步安全降级指南
MySQL运维优化实战方案解析
MySQL中IN与等号:高效查询差异解析